Transaction 3196e2bdb5fb592ab28586903bf158558c65055d577c9d36cbfacf29b9f101b8
1 Input
1 Output
-
3196e2bdb5fb592ab28586903bf158558c65055d577c9d36cbfacf29b9f101b8:0
- value
- 8287
- script pubkey
- OP_0 OP_PUSHBYTES_20 685c2ec7aa15ad087cb1dac539523ff133b1b4bf
- address
- bc1qdpwza3a2zkkssl93mtznj53l7yemrd9lfh7vvf